To parse windows 10 prefetch files use 505forensics script5. Thats why with the help of dedicated volunteers around the world we make the firefox browser available in more than 90 languages. Prefetching boot files and applications decreases the time needed to start windows xp and start applications. Jun 08, 2007 its also a waste of cpu and bandwidth that slows firefox down. Lnk file analysis with link parser windows forensics.
To analyze many prefetch files in a directory, the. Jun 12, 2014 download prefetch clean and control a userfriendly and powerful tool that allows you to clear the prefetch folder, disable the prefetch feature, as well as gain control over the monitoring process. Prefetching data is the process whereby data that is expected to be requested is read ahead into the cache. A web page provides a set of prefetching hints to the browser, and after the browser is finished loading the page, it begins silently prefetching specified documents and stores them in its cache.
Apr 27, 20 firefox users can disable this prefetch feature the following way. The output of the script is a powershell object making it. If ran without any parameters it parses all the files in c. Mozilla source code directory structure mozilla mdn. Prefetch is a feature, introduced in windows xp and still used in windows 10, that stores specific data about the applications you run in order to help them start faster. By monitoring these files, windows xp can prefetch them. Nov 25, 2015 a great place to see which executables that have been run on a system is looking in the prefetch folder, and parsing the files within.
Lnk file analysis with link parser link parser is another free tool that can be used by digital forensic examiners for microsoft shell link files. If you delete the prefetch files, then the system must start from scratch and recreate the files as you use the computer. Just doubleclick the item in the list to change it to false. Rolling your own incident response with powershell. Firefox users can disable this prefetch feature the following way. The tree contains the source code as well as the code required to build each project on supported platforms linux, windows, macos, etc.
When you are using the computer, the prefetch files are created for the programs you normally use most often. Prefetch is an algorithm that helps anticipate cache misses times when windows requests data that isnt stored in the disk cache, and stores that data on the hard disk for. Forensic tools available for download for windows and linux. Download windows xp prefetch clean and control majorgeeks. Every time you update firefox, the update installer turns prefetch back on again, so you need to enter the config screen and toggle it to false again, once there if you right click the network. How to delete temporary files and delete prefetch files from. Prefetch next line the small menu has an option to toggle, that will change it. The data is displayed in the console as well as bookmarked. Android browser, firefox browser, and firefox mobile browser starts prefetching after window. Using prefetch as a proactive approach predictive browser. Chrome, on the other hand, downloads up to 10 resources in parallel.
Using the definition in wikipedia, the prefetcher is a component of versions of microsoft windows starting with windows xp. It looks at process creation times and windows does prefetch after creating the. Windows maintains prefetch files in the prefetch folder for up to the 128 most recently launched programs. Firefox source code directory structure firefox source. The prefetcher stores its trace files in the prefetch folder inside the windows folder typically. Choose which firefox browser to download in your language everyone deserves access to the internet your language should never be a barrier. For some of us is difficult to clean prefetch, but now i made a script which can help you. It is the files on disk driving the process not the other way around. The prefetch files are not used by every run of defrag. Python script created to parse windows prefetch files.
Prefetch parser outputs the content of a prefetch file. Here is a powershell script to parse prefetch files. This enscript was written to search unallocated cluster for deleted prefetch data. If a user doesnt use outlook, they are likely to use thunderbird. If this is done, windows will need to recreate all the prefetch files again, thereby slowing down windows during boot and program starts until the prefetch files are createdunless the prefetcher is disabled. The image and stylesheet issue is merely about whether well prefetch them while being blocked.
To add, delete, or modify this preference, you will need to edit your configuration do not edit this article. Has any one else completed the autopsy class with a linux machine and willing to let me pick. By using this application, you can get a better understanding on. You can give it a directory or just one file if you want. This parser supports all known versions from windows xp to windows 10. Pf format stored in your system, create reports and export data to an array of file formats html, txt, csv, xml. Furthermore, if you disable superfetch and want to enable it for individual applications, you can use a particular switch in the program shortcut. When the browser is blocked on a script, a second lightweight parser scans the rest of the markup looking for other resources e. A great place to see which executables that have been run on a system is looking in the prefetch folder, and parsing the files within. The title given to this article is incorrect due to technical limitations. Preload, prefetch and priorities in chrome reloading. Windows prefetch ive heard that windows xp will run faster if you disable something called prefetch. The new tool from eric zimmerman helps to solve the problem parse prefetch version 30.
The code for all projects in the mozilla family such as firefox, thunderbird, etc. You can get a command line tool that uses this libary here. In conjunction with the library eric also released pecmd which is version 0. Thunderbird mailbox parsing with autopsy thunderbird is a free and open source mail client from mozilla, the developers of the firefox browser. Prefetch file parsing with pecmd windows forensics cookbook. These files contain information about the files loaded by the application. You can view prefetch files on windows and delete them without causing any issue to windows remember, these are just temporary files. Confirm that you will be careful if this is your first time you are opening the page.
Prefetch files are used in the windows operating system to optimize the loading time of a windows application on subsequent runs. Eric zimmerman released windows 10 prefetch parser digital. It is a component of the memory manager that can speed up the windows boot process and shorten the amount of time it takes to start up programs. May 16, 2016 if you are a windows user then you could compile and use eric zimmermans windows prefetch parser which supports all known versions from windows xp to windows 10. Parser for firefox cache version 1 files firefox 31 or earlier.
Apparently windows remembers everything you have done and, in a misguided attempt to be helpful, preloads all the files and links when xp boots. Firefox will prefetch certain links if any of the websites you are viewing uses the special prefetchlink tag. I am having a minor glitch with my antivirus which says it has removed 3 cookies but if i run the scan again it always comes up with the same 3 cookes and then says resolved. In addition, you should check the great prefetch 101 poster that jared atkinson made. Link parser has extracted data from 204 lnk files, as seen in the following figure. Select the start button if you wish to launch the service. Option 3 terminal command macos from the finder, select go utilities. Firefox downloads one prefetch at a time whenever it is idle. Additionally, the folks from microsoft say that fiddling with the prefetch setting in the registry or the contents of the c.
It accomplishes this by caching files that are needed by an application to ram as the application is launched, thus consolidating disk reads and reducing disk seeks. Disable firefox prefetch and save bandwidth megaleecher. The windows application prefetch mechanism was put in place to offer performance benefits when launching applications. Only the one that occurs periodically and is initiated by windows. Type prefetchand click ok button to open prefetch folder. This description is mainly based on the awesome work done at forensics wiki. If found, the enscript will parse out the name of the executable, last run time and run count. In web browsers, prefetch is just about the dumbest, and highest security risk that comes turned on by default. A crossplatform api, with implementations on each platform, for dealing with operating systemenvironment widgets, i.
You can download the python source code for log2timeline from. Any digital forensic investigator or analyst has already known, that prefetchfile format in windows 10 changed. We also provide an extensive windows 7 tutorial section that covers a wide range of tips and tricks. Prefetch file parsing with pecmd if you have found some suspicious prefetch files and want to perform indepth analysis, there is another tool by eric zimmerman that can help you pecmd. The output of the script is a powershell object making it easy to output the result to a csv or xml file. Download prefetch clean and control a userfriendly and powerful tool that allows you to clear the prefetch folder, disable the prefetch feature, as well as gain control over the monitoring process. Hello rickcanham, it is not important because it is a prefetch file, go from start run type prefetch and delete the file and if you want any file in the prefetch folder, actually do it from time to time it is where windows prefetches data when the system starts, then try to restart firefox. On future i will ad more features in this cleaner, and a friendly interface. Back directx enduser runtime web installer next directx enduser runtime web installer. Im not quite sure how i feel about mozilla prefetching content without the users ever. Sep 29, 2009 microsoft download manager is free and available for download now. For more information, please see the link prefetching faq. The prefetcher is a component of microsoft windows which was introduced in windows xp. Firefox win32 l10n builds broke since jun 8th because win2008r2 check not avail in nsis 2.
If you dont want firefox to do this then youll have to manually go and disable it. The contentprefetcher class provides mechanisms for specifying resources that windows should attempt to download in advance of your app being launched by the user. Eric zimmerman released windows 10 prefetch parser. This is a free and fast commandline tool capable of parsing windows prefetch files, both in old and new formats. Prefetchnext line the small menu has an option to toggle, that will change it.
Superfetch how to enabledisable prefetch on windows. Right now, while the parser is blocked we only prefetch scripts which is likely the biggest win, since if we get them by the time we restart the parser, we wont have to block again. Heuristics are used to determine when prefetching should occur and which resources will be downloaded. Note that the task scheduler is the process responsible for parsing the trace data collected by. How to stop firefox from making automatic connections. Digital forensics prefetch artifacts count upon security. Lnk file analysis with link parser windows forensics cookbook. Though there are many tools like nirsoft winprefetchviewer and couple of more available. I thought of creating one internally for my organization. While prefetch is a mechanism used to speed up system boot andor application launch, the metadata contained in these files are a goldmine when trying to piece together a timeline and attack scenario.
Windows forensics with plaso compass security blog. The process known as prefetch dynamic link library belongs to software prefetch dynamic link library by slipstream data. Its also a waste of cpu and bandwidth that slows firefox down. Make sure you have at least windows 8 before running this code. But, having files in prefetch that dont match to any ones being defragged will have no affect on anything. Below is an example of how much data is outputted on a typical prefetch file in verbose mode. The preloader then starts retrieving these resources in the background with the aim that by the time the main html parser reaches them they may. Deleting files in prefetch folder microsoft community. Firefox will prefetch certain links if any of the websites you are viewing uses the special prefetch link tag. A tech support person from norton deleted temp files and then wants to. Go to the organize dropdown button, and select folder and search options.
Hello rickcanham, it is not important because it is a prefetch file, go from start run type prefetch and delete the file and if you want any file in the prefetch folder, actually do it from time to time it is where windows prefetches data when the system starts, then try to restart firefox if you select to unistall firefox do not select to remove your personal data, your profile data. Link prefetching is a browser mechanism, which utilizes browser idle time to download or prefetch documents that the user might visit in the near future. Our forum is dedicated to helping you find support and solutions for any problems regarding your windows 7 pc be it dell, hp, acer, asus or a custom build. Windows 10 disable and enable prefetch and superfetch by default, the computer stores prefetch data in c.
902 873 1293 902 123 1289 797 1463 64 55 1063 191 1559 103 466 1588 26 502 61 70 1157 849 1145 1210 844 770 1418 755 1295 428 957